|
本帖最后由 jerry8192 于 2011-11-25 21:31 编辑
dseg02:0002BA03 loc_2BA03: ; CODE XREF: sub_2B483+501j
dseg02:0002BA03 imul eax, ebx, 0B6h
dseg02:0002BA09 imul ebx, ebp, 0BEh
dseg02:0002BA0F mov dx, word_A27AC[ebx] ; 加攻擊力
dseg02:0002BA16 add word_901A2[eax], dx ; 攻擊力
dseg02:0002BA16 ;
dseg02:0002BA1D mov dx, word_A27AE[ebx] ; 加輕功
dseg02:0002BA24 add word_901A4[eax], dx ; 輕功
dseg02:0002BA2B mov dx, word_A27B0[ebx] ; 加防禦
dseg02:0002BA32 add word_901A6[eax], dx ; 防禦力
dseg02:0002BA39 mov dx, word_A27B2[ebx] ; 加醫療
dseg02:0002BA40 add word_901A8[eax], dx ; 醫療能力
dseg02:0002BA47 mov dx, word_A27B4[ebx] ; 加用毒
dseg02:0002BA4E add word_901AA[eax], dx ; 用毒能力
dseg02:0002BA55 mov dx, word_A27B6[ebx] ; 加解毒
dseg02:0002BA5C add word_901AC[eax], dx ; 解毒能力
dseg02:0002BA63 mov dx, word_A27B8[ebx] ; 加抗毒
dseg02:0002BA6A add word_901AE[eax], dx ; 抗毒能力
dseg02:0002BA71 mov dx, word_A27BA[ebx] ; 加拳掌
dseg02:0002BA78 add word_901B0[eax], dx ; 拳掌能力
dseg02:0002BA78 ;
dseg02:0002BA7F mov dx, word_A27BC[ebx] ; 加御劍
dseg02:0002BA86 add word_901B2[eax], dx ; 御劍能力
dseg02:0002BA8D mov dx, word_A27BE[ebx] ; 加耍刀
dseg02:0002BA94 add word_901B4[eax], dx ; 耍刀能力
dseg02:0002BA9B mov dx, word_A27C0[ebx] ; 加特殊
dseg02:0002BAA2 add word_901B6[eax], dx ; 特殊兵器
dseg02:0002BAA9 mov dx, word_A27C2[ebx] ; 增加暗器
dseg02:0002BAB0 add word_901B8[eax], dx ; 暗器技巧
dseg02:0002BAB7 mov dx, word_A27C4[ebx] ; 增加武學
dseg02:0002BABE add word_901BA[eax], dx ; 武學常識
dseg02:0002BAC5 mov dx, word_A27CA[ebx] ; 增加攻擊帶毒
dseg02:0002BACC add word_901BE[eax], dx ; 攻擊帶毒
例如:白嵐氏雞精(吃了變聰明)、金牛運功散(吃了治內傷,也就是減少受傷程度)!
就是把變量值 add word_901BA[eax], dx ; 武學常識、add word_901BE[eax], dx ; 攻擊帶毒改成
add word_90172[eax], dx ; 受傷程度、add word_901C4[eax], dx ; 資質,吃下去一定超過 100,以及受傷程度減少到小於0,表示已經吃過頭了!但是空間不夠,就是沒辦法限制到 100,以及大於等於0,已經用過 call 指令,也已經做過重定位,但卻根本進不了遊戲,那不就是 Z.EXE 主程序問題!
|
|